@charset "utf-8";
/* CSS Document */
/**
 * @description: 网站首页样式
 * @author: ishang_pan
 * @update: ishang_pan (2020-06-16 09:25)
 */

/*主体*/
.is-main{background-color: #f0f0f0;background-image: url(../images/home/bg-big.png);background-repeat: no-repeat;background-position: bottom center;}
.banner .group{height: auto;}
.location{width: 100%;height: 55px;line-height: 55px;background: url(../images/home/location.png)no-repeat left center;padding-left: 30px;color: #999999;}
.location a{color: #999999;}
.list-box{min-height: 800px;}
.list-box .left{width: 20%;background: #e9e9e9;min-height: 800px;}
.list-box .left ul li{height: 84px;line-height: 84px;text-align: center;border-bottom: 1px dashed #cccccc;padding: 0 10px;overflow: hidden;word-wrap: normal;white-space: nowrap;text-overflow: ellipsis;}}
.list-box .left ul li a{background: url(../images/home/85693496739.png)no-repeat left;padding-left: 20px;font-size: 17px;}
.list-box .left .title{font-size: 23px;overflow: hidden;word-wrap: normal;white-space: nowrap;text-overflow: ellipsis;}
.list-box .left .u-active{background: linear-gradient(to left,#a61315,#d20c0c,#a61315);}
.list-box .left .u-active a{color: #fff;background: url(../images/home/045869458694.png)no-repeat left ;}

.list-box .right{position:relative;width: 80%;background: #fff;padding: 40px;min-height: 800px;}
.list-box .right .title{height: 38px;border-bottom: 1px solid #dddddd;}
.list-box .right .title h4{position: absolute;font-size:20px;border-bottom:4px solid #d20c0c;text-align: center;padding-bottom: 11px;}
.list-box .right .list-ul{padding: 20px 0;border-bottom: 1px dashed #dddddd;}
.list-box .right .list-ul li{background: url(../images/home/dian.png)no-repeat left;padding-left: 15px;line-height: 38px;overflow: hidden;word-wrap: normal;white-space: nowrap;text-overflow: ellipsis;}
.list-box .right .list-ul li span{float: right;color: #999999;font-size: 14px;}
.list-box .right .m-onelist img{width:100%;}

/* 内容 */
.content{width: 80%;background: #fff;padding: 40px;min-height: 800px;}
.content h4{font-size:32px;text-align: center;line-height: 44px;}
.content .m-dtfuns,.content .m-dtfuns a{color: #999999;font-size: 15px;}
.content .m-dtfuns{margin-top: 20px;}
#zoom p{text-indent: 2em;}
#zoom img{text-align: center;max-width: 100%;}
.m-btfuns{border-bottom: 1px solid #dddddd;}
.m-dtcode p {font-size: 12px;color: #999;text-align: center;}
.m-dtcode img {margin: 4px auto;display: block;width: 120px;height: 120px;padding: 4px;border: 1px solid #ddd;}
.m-btfuns li {float: left;margin-right: 19px;line-height: 38px;}
.m-btfuns .j-goTop{background: url(../images/home/icon-detail-pl.png);background-repeat: no-repeat;background-position: 0 5px;}
.m-btfuns .u-print{background: url(../images/home/icon-detail-pl.png);background-repeat: no-repeat;background-position: 0 -78px;}
.m-btfuns .u-close{background: url(../images/home/icon-detail-pl.png);background-repeat: no-repeat; background-position: 0 -106px;}
.m-btfuns a {display: block;font-size: 13px;padding-left: 17px;}
.m-dtsxqh ul li{line-height: 38px;}


/* 网站地图 */
.map{height: 100%;background: #fff;padding: 50px;}
.map .title{border-bottom: 1px solid #dddddd;}
.map .title h4 {width: 110px;font-size: 20px; border-bottom: 4px solid #d20c0c;text-align: center;padding-bottom: 11px;}
.map .textcontent{margin-top: 30px;}
.textcontent h6 {font-size: 20px;line-height: 20px;border-left: solid 6px #d20c0c;padding-left: 10px;margin-bottom: 20px;}
.textcontent ul {margin-bottom: 30px;margin-left: 6px;}
.textcontent li {padding: 6px 10px;border: solid 1px #fff;float: left;margin-right: 10px;font-size: 16px;}
.textcontent li:hover{border: 1px solid #d20c0c;}


/*企业文化*/
.g-bear{height: 520px;background: #fff;}
.g-bear .tit-switch ul{padding-top: 25px;padding-bottom: 40px;}
.g-bear .tit-switch ul li{float: left;padding: 0 55px;}
.g-bear .bear-tit {height: 230px;margin: 0 20px;background: #f5f5f5;padding: 0 25px;}
.g-bear .bear-tit h4{line-height: 65px;font-size:24px;}
.g-bear .bear-tit p{line-height: 34px;text-indent: 2em;}


/*视频页*/
.m-pgpdbox1{background:#fff;}
.m-listpicture>ul>li img{width:100%;}
.m-listpicture>ul>li p{line-height:40px;text-align:center;}
/*主体结束*/

/*media query*/
/*large pcScreen*/
@media screen and (min-width:1280px) {
	
}

@media screen and (max-width:1280px) {
	.g-bear .tit-switch ul li {padding: 0 47px;}
}

/*medium pcScreen lg*/
@media screen and (max-width: 1199px) {
	.g-bear .tit-switch ul li {padding: 0 22px;}
}
/*pad md*/
@media screen and (max-width: 991px ){
	.list-box .left,.list-box .right,.content{width: 100%;}
	.list-box .left,.list-box .right,.content{min-height:auto;}
	.g-bear .tit-switch ul li {margin-bottom: 20px;}
	.g-bear,.g-bear .bear-tit{height: auto;padding-bottom: 20px;}
}
/*phone sm*/
@media screen and (max-width: 767px) {
}
@media screen and (max-width: 490px){
	.banner .group{width: auto;}
	.g-bear .tit-switch ul li{width: 50%;}
	.g-bear .tit-switch ul li img{width: 100%;}
}

